Post-traumatic high thoracic kyphosis, posterior approach with correction and fusion in two steps
Brayda-Bruno Marco MD
IRCCS IIstituto Ortopedico Galeazzi
Via Riccardo Galeazzi 4
20161 Milan
Italy
Project 12-010
A posterior approach in a 58-year-old female patient with paraplegia after a car accident, with correction and fusion in two steps is demonstrated in a patient with a posttraumatic high thoracic angular kyphosis.
